Definition of incubates:

(v) : (transitive) To brood, raise, or maintain eggs, organisms, or living tissue through the provision of ideal environmental conditions.
(v) : (transitive, figurative) To incubate metaphorically; to ponder an idea slowly and deliberately as if in preparation for hatching it.
(n) : (biology or chemistry) A preparation, or material, that has been incubated.
